Cette semaine, j'ai travaillé sur l'élaboration des différentes mécaniques de bases.
Lors de notre poursuite, le personnage fait usage d'un jetpack pour traverser de longues étendues de ''vide'' mortel. J'ai donc prototyper:
- Le jetpack
- Comprenant un système d'essence rechargeable après délai, tant que l'on reste au sol
- Deccélaration progressive pour une chute douce
- Interface diégétique (représenté par une tête de singe changeant progressivement de couleur pour réprésenter l'essence disponible)
- Ouverture de nombreuses variables pour le Level Designer
- Système de Respawn pour chute dans le vide
- Système à point fixe de respawn et de Death box pouvant être facilement placé par le Level Designer,
- Caméra restant fixe dans l'espace lors du contact avec le Death Box, avec un ''look at'' suivant le personnage dans sa chute (variable de temps exposé)
Ces blueprints sont présent dans le projet Unreal sur le Perforce
Exemple de Blueprint
Blueprint du Personnage Principal
Jauge Pleine
Jauge à moitié vide
Personnage utilisant le jetpack, carburant presque vide
Caméra fixant le joueur dans sa chute, avant de suivre le personnage ''respawné''
